Re: DNA evidence
I have been reading a lot of social media posts claiming Heather's DNA was found in the Moorer house or on their property. I have been unable to find a statement from LE to confirm this. I did find the following..
The Solicitor's statements in an interview immediately after the bond hearing on Monday..
"Capt. Dale Buchanan with Horry County Police said, "We have evidence that will be processed with us. SLED is assisting us with processing some of the forensic evidence. Is some of that evidence DNA? Yes."

This is the only LE statement I can find mentioning DNA evidence. IMO, this statement does not confirm any results from DNA processing was received prior to the murder charges being filed. This statement only confirms DNA evidence was found and is being processed. Also, while we can all assume LE feels the DNA belongs to Heather , who the DNA belonged to has not been confirmed .
